Bio for Vincent Moretti

Anthony Moretti is a first generation Italian-American who currently resides in Las Vegas by way of Boston, MA. Anthony was raised by Italian immigrant parents that believed in hard work. His parents exhaustive work schedules allowed for Anthony to freely roam the streets at an early age. Although Anthony is grateful today, he sure took advantage of being one of the few that spoke English in his family. Both of his parents worked multiple jobs to help support the family and provide a better life for Anthony. For this reason Anthony is forever indebted to his family.

It was very hard for Anthony to focus on school when his friends were always around to help persuade him to hang out on the streets. Anthony learned at an early age that his size was an intimidating characteristic which he could use to his advantage. Anthony claims to have never started a fight but he has never backed down from one either. After numerous run ins with the police for fighting and disturbances, Anthony was guided to the boxing ring where he dreamed of following Rocky Marciano ’s footsteps. Anthony was a successful young boxer becoming a regional Golden Gloves champion and was an intimidation force in the ring using his raw power and quickness to dismantle many young men that opposed him. Anthony was labeled "Tony Touch" given by his trainer referring to the "touch of sleep" he would give opponents after knocking them out.

While Tony found refuge in the ring it was becoming very difficult for his trainers and mentors to get him to show up for training sessions. As Tony grew older he was discouraged by how much his parents labored compared to how little they were compensated. Tony would routinely miss training to roam the streets with his friends in search of money making opportunities. At one point Tony was introduced to an uncle of his friend who allegedly ran an underground bookmaking operation. Uncle Nico allowed the boys to hang around his apartment and watch the Red Sox and Celtics and ultimately introduced them to his underground bookmaking operation.

Tony saw this as his opportunity to earn money and quickly became a fixture around Uncle Nico. Tony was often sent to collect money from degenerate gamblers who failed to pay Uncle Nico for lost wagers. As Tony grew older and more knowledgeable about sports wagering and line setting he realized the opportunities that Las Vegas could offer. Tony was often left in charge of the bookmaking operation Uncle Nico ran and was known for setting his own lines. Tony had a passion for Boston sports and it quickly became a passion for making money on all sports. From basketball to horse racing, Tony and Uncle Nico would accept all wagers, under their terms and lines of course.

At the age of 29 Tony decided to pack up and move to Las Vegas with high hopes of legally breaking into the sports gambling industry. Tony was introduced to many influential people in Las Vegas by his Boston connections.
